Output 5afd3edded29c5a858c4f9610985e1e95d8a5b8f1a71f6b36e034f651ae5b4f8:0

value
912496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d78e51387881b2c7d83c768685f6715b37eb181a OP_EQUAL
address
3MLmhAVNpcifNHASXfVyGPbN5WTNXauybn
transaction
5afd3edded29c5a858c4f9610985e1e95d8a5b8f1a71f6b36e034f651ae5b4f8
confirmations
249452
spent
true